Integration of Advanced Technologies
As global travel rebounds and expectations evolve, airport transportation has become more than just a means of reaching the terminal. Today’s travelers are demanding efficiency and convenience at every turn, and the integration of smart technology is meeting those needs. Airports worldwide are fast-tracking the implementation of biometric verification, such as facial and fingerprint recognition, allowing for a seamless flow through check-in, security, and boarding. Touchless systems and real-time data updates not only speed up the process but also ensure heightened passenger safety and satisfaction.

Enhanced Ground Transportation Options
Ground transportation has evolved far beyond simple taxi and rental car options. Major airports are now partnering with dedicated shuttle services, rail lines, and ride-sharing networks to simplify access for all passengers. The success of services like the FlyAway bus in Los Angeles demonstrates the value of such strategic alliances, providing nonstop routes between airport terminals and busy urban centers while dramatically reducing road congestion. These innovations not only facilitate smoother travel but also help minimize individual vehicle use, paving the way for cleaner urban environments.
The availability of multiple ground transportation modes allows travelers to customize their journeys based on schedule, budget, or sustainability concerns. Apps and digital platforms further streamline access, enabling users to compare fares, view real-time availability, and book rides instantly. This flexibility has elevated the importance of ground transportation in shaping positive airport experiences.
Focus on Sustainability
A growing focus on climate change and sustainability is influencing every aspect of modern travel. Airport shuttle providers, local transit systems, and even major airlines are pivoting toward greener fuel and fleet upgrades. Electric and hybrid shuttles now transport thousands daily, directly reducing carbon emissions. Additionally, infrastructure projects such as solar-powered charging stations or dedicated lanes for green vehicles underscore the airport industry’s long-term commitment to eco-friendly operations.
Travelers increasingly seek services that align with their values. As a result, selecting eco-conscious transportation providers has become a priority for both individuals and organizations managing large-scale travel. Forward-thinking brands are responding through public green initiatives, transparency in emissions reporting, and continuous investment in sustainable technologies.
Improved Passenger Amenities
The passenger experience inside airports is being revolutionized with modern amenities and digital-first upgrades. Virtual security queues, advanced self-service kiosks, and mobile boarding passes eliminate the stress and uncertainty that once defined airport travel. Pilot programs at leading U.S. airports such as Seattle-Tacoma and Los Angeles International are already reducing wait times and creating a more relaxed atmosphere for passengers on tight schedules.
Meanwhile, the focus on passenger well-being extends to comfort features like smart lounges, wellness zones, and on-demand concierge services. With robust Wi-Fi, tech-enabled wayfinding, and AI-driven support desks, travelers can manage every step of their airport experience from a single device.
Seamless Connectivity
The integration of airports with broader smart city infrastructure ensures that travelers remain connected and informed from the doorstep to the destination. In cities like Seoul, real-time updates from 5G networks provide instant information on gate changes, crowd flow, and efficient ground transport solutions. AI-driven traffic management systems help ease congestion around major transport hubs, reducing delays and improving access for everyone.
Platforms focused on mobility innovation help travelers anticipate challenges and uncover the best local options, adding a layer of intelligence to travel planning that was previously unavailable. This results in less time waiting, more efficient journeys, and greater adaptability when plans change.

Personalized Travel Experiences
Data-driven personalization is now at the core of top-tier airport services. Artificial intelligence enables airlines and ground transport providers to offer custom recommendations—ranging from route adjustments to special amenity access—based on loyalty program data, travel history, and real-time preferences. For example, Singapore Airlines uses AI to anticipate passenger needs and deliver timely, relevant support.
Such personalized touches not only make travel more convenient but also foster greater brand loyalty by forging memorable, individualized interactions. As this technology advances, travelers should expect even more intuitive service and tailored options throughout every phase of their journey.
Enhanced Security Measures
Security is evolving to be both faster and smarter. The implementation of next-generation scanning devices and biometric systems across major international hubs, such as London Heathrow, has set a new standard for passenger safety and efficiency. These improvements mean travelers can expect shorter lines, fewer manual checks, and a more comfortable experience, all while maintaining the highest levels of protection against emerging threats.
According to recent industry research, a significant majority of airports plan to enhance their biometric capabilities by 2030, making advanced security a future-proof cornerstone of travel. This commitment ensures that both efficiency and safety remain at the forefront of global airport operations.
